Instructions. Remove the stalk and unseed the dried peppers or chillies. Cook chilies and onion in boiling water for 5 minutes. Drain chillies. Put them in the blender with the vinegar, garlic, oregano, cumin, cloves, pineapple juice, salt and pepper. It can refer to a sauce, seasoning, or general style of cooking.Feb 24, 2024 · How to store Mexican Adobo. Mexican Adobo will keep well in the refrigerator for up to 2 weeks and in the freezer for up to 3 months. If storing in the refrigerator, simply scoop it into a jar or airtight container and pop it into the fridge. Mexican adobo seasoning may sound exotic, but its ingredients are all common sights on the spice rack. When combined, they make a flavorful mix that’s just as perfect as a guacamole seasoning as it is a barbecue steak rub.
